Technology & materials
Each work in the Modern Madonnas series is a unique original – analog, genuine, tangible. There is no retouching here, it is layered, torn, applied. Layer by layer, different materials are applied, reworked, destroyed and rebuilt until the surface not only develops depth, but also its very own dynamic. The result: contemporary collage art with character – lively, authentic, inimitable.
- Technique: oil crayon, acrylic and printed photography, collage on cardboard
- Carrier material: cardboard
- Format: 51 × 70 cm (outer dimensions) – 34 × 40 cm (image size)
- Authenticity: Hand-signed, certified, unique

The creative process
There is no fixed scheme in the Modern Madonnas series. Each work emerges from the interplay of material and intuition. The collages are not planned in advance – they develop in the process.
Traces of manual work, small irregularities, intentional imperfections – the process remains visible here. The works live from the human touch: from visible interventions that show that it was not a machine but a person who worked on them. It is precisely this imperfection that makes them an authentic example of contemporary collage art.
Each picture is created in close collaboration: the photographic basis is created by Martin Wieland, while the collage, overpainting and material combinations are developed and implemented by art director Dietmar Halbauer.
